Principal Cost/Price Estimator - Aerospace

Our client a well-respected aerospace company in Suffolk County is seeking a Principal Cost/Price Estimator. They are offering a highly competitive salary and great benefits ($90,000-$120,000). This is a critical role within their Contracts/Pricing department, responsible for developing, maintaining, and implementing complex cost and price models for aerospace products and services. This position requires a highly analytical individual with deep experience in cost estimating, pricing strategy, and contract review. The ideal candidate will be a self-starter experienced collaborating effectively with cross-functional teams. This role involves a significant focus (75-80%) on detailed pricing model development and maintenance, with the remaining time (20-25%) dedicated to contract review, compliance, and team management.

Responsibilities:

  • Cost/Price Model Development & Maintenance (75-80%):
    • Develop and maintain sophisticated cost and price models using various estimating techniques (e.g., parametric, analogous, bottom-up) to accurately capture all cost elements (labor, materials, overhead, etc.) for complex aerospace projects.
    • Analyze historical cost data, market trends, and technical specifications to ensure model accuracy and competitiveness.
    • Collaborate with engineering, manufacturing, procurement, and other departments to gather necessary data inputs for cost estimation.
    • Regularly update and refine cost models to reflect changes in market conditions, material costs, labor rates, and manufacturing processes.
    • Conduct sensitivity analyses and risk assessments to identify potential cost variances and develop mitigation strategies.
    • Prepare detailed cost and price proposals for submission to customers, ensuring compliance with all regulatory requirements (e.g., FAR, DFARS).
    • Support negotiation efforts with customers by providing clear and concise explanations of cost and pricing methodologies.
    • Develop and maintain documentation for all cost models, including assumptions, methodologies, and data sources.
  • Contract Review & Compliance (20-25%):
    • Review and analyze contracts, Non-Disclosure Agreements (NDAs), and other legal documents to ensure compliance with company policies and regulatory requirements.
    • Identify potential risks and opportunities within contracts and provide recommendations to management.
    • Support internal audits and reviews of contract performance.
    • Maintain accurate records of contracts and related documentation.


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Engineering, Business Administration, or a related field.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in cost estimating and pricing within the aerospace industry.
  • Understanding of aerospace manufacturing processes, materials, and technologies.
  • Extensive experience in developing and implementing complex cost and price models.
  • Strong knowledge of FAR, DFARS, and other relevant government regulations.
  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ills (written and verbal).
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Experience in contract review and negotiation.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and meet deadlines.
  • U.S. Citizenship required
